E. Dee Stasen, of Salem NH passed away Wednesday April 6 at the age of 81. Dee was born, raised and educated in Haverhill, Massachusetts, where she lived until her marriage to the late Peter J. Stasen after which she relocated to New York. Dee settled in Salem NH with her parents Christos and Georgia Dantos in the early 1980’s.
Dee was quite accomplished as an executive secretary at Playtex in the Empire State Building in New York and at the Merrimack Paper Company in Lawrence.
Dee, who worshipped at the Saint Constantine & Helen Greek Orthodox Church in Andover was a member of the Philoptohos Society, the Daughters of Penelope and a recipient of the Diocesan Award.
